| Aspect | Plant Operations Intern | Plant Maintenance Technician |
|---|
| Credentials | Typically pursuing or recent graduate in engineering, industrial, or related fields | Technical certifications or vocational training in maintenance or HVAC systems |
| Work Environment | Internship setting within manufacturing or energy plants, learning-focused | Hands-on maintenance work in industrial plant environments |
| Employer & Industry Usage | Used by companies to train future professionals, often seasonal or temporary | Full-time role for ongoing plant upkeep and repairs |
The main difference is that a Plant Operations Intern is a learning position aimed at gaining industry experience, while a Plant Maintenance Technician is a skilled, full-time role focused on maintaining and repairing plant equipment. Interns typically have less experience and work under supervision, whereas technicians perform routine and complex maintenance tasks independently.
